Transaction 69d79fe6ebf4c3555ebd95ca6ca972ce80abc39c4f3f763591f18f264a1e1c73
2 Input
2 Outputs
- 69d79fe6ebf4c3555ebd95ca6ca972ce80abc39c4f3f763591f18f264a1e1c73:0
- 69d79fe6ebf4c3555ebd95ca6ca972ce80abc39c4f3f763591f18f264a1e1c73:1
value 99827437
address 1hLkEPt4EjJBSG6ZfHTusLvdsUkjFXfpG
value 100000000
address 18PtRY8sNPYPceni1L4crgPF6oHtp1WMt9